What's the Greatest Common Factor (GCF) of 111, 324 and 432?

Answer

GCF of 111, 324 and 432 is
3

(Three)

3 is the largest positive integer that divides 111, 324 and 432 without a remainder — every other common divisor of the three divides it too.

Finding the GCF of 111, 324 and 432 by Prime Factorization

Split all three numbers into prime factors, then keep every prime that appears in all three of them, each taken as many times as it appears in the poorest factorization. Multiplying what is left gives the greatest common factor:

All Prime Factors of 111: 3 × 37 (exponent form: 3 × 37)

All Prime Factors of 324: 2 × 2 × 3 × 3 × 3 × 3 (exponent form: 22 × 34)

All Prime Factors of 432: 2 × 2 × 2 × 2 × 3 × 3 × 3 (exponent form: 24 × 33)

Checking the GCF of 111, 324 and 432 Two Numbers at a Time

The greatest common factor is associative, so three numbers can be handled as two pairs — and this is what makes the Euclidean algorithm usable here: run it on the first pair, then run it again on that result and the third number.

GCF(a, b, c) = GCF(GCF(a, b), c)

GCF(111, 324) = 3

GCF(3, 432) = 3

GCF(111, 324, 432) = 3

The answer checks out by division — all three quotients come out whole:

111 ÷ 3 = 37

324 ÷ 3 = 108

432 ÷ 3 = 144

37, 108 and 144 have no common factor left — that is what makes 3 the greatest one.
